Comprehending Swedish Pharmaceutical Regulations
Sweden's pharmaceutical market is strictly kept track of by the Medical Products Agency (Läkemedelsverket). The primary objective of this agency is to make sure that all medications sold-- whether needing a medical professional's permission or not-- are safe, Buy Pain Killers With Coupon Codes Sweden reliable, and effectively identified.
Unlike some countries where a variety of analgesics can be discovered in gas stations, benefit stores, and supermarkets, Sweden traditionally restricted the sale of all pharmaceuticals solely to state-owned drug stores (Apoteket). Although the marketplace was decontrolled in 2009 to enable personal drug store chains, the sale of medications stays heavily controlled.
What You Can and Can not Buy OTC
Normally speaking, moderate analgesics and antipyretics are available over-the-counter. However, more powerful opioids, heavy prescription-strength anti-inflammatories, and specialized nerve pain medications require a formal examination and prescription from a certified Swedish doctor.
Common Over-the-Counter Painkillers in Sweden
When going to a Swedish drug store (apotek), people will discover a number of basic, internationally acknowledged active components. Nevertheless, trademark name might vary from those in the United States, the UK, or the rest of Europe.

Crucial Buying Restrictions
To fight drug abuse and accidental overdoses, Swedish pharmacies enforce particular guidelines on OTC purchases:
- Quantity Limits: Customers are frequently limited to buying only one or two packages of paracetamol-based products at a time.
- Age Verification: Buyers need to be at least 18 years old to acquire standard over the counter painkillers like paracetamol and ibuprofen in tablet kind.
- Supervised Placement: Unlike numerous nations where painkillers sit freely on supermarket endcaps, in Sweden, non-prescription medications in pharmacies are frequently put behind the counter or in monitored areas to motivate consultation with a pharmacist (farmaceut).
Safe Usage and When to See a Doctor
Self-medicating with over the counter painkillers prevails for severe, short-term pain. Nevertheless, consumers should always stick to finest practices:
- Read the Package Leaflet (Bipacksedel): Every medication sold in Sweden includes comprehensive directions in Swedish. Digital translations are widely readily available via smartphone apps if needed.
- Do Not Combine Illicitly: Combining paracetamol with alcohol or doubling up on various NSAIDs (like ibuprofen and naproxen) without medical suggestions can result in extreme organ damage, particularly to the liver and stomach.
- Period of Use: OTC pain relievers are developed for short-term relief (usually no greater than 3-- 5 days for fevers or headaches without seeking advice from a physician).

2. Can tourists purchase pain relievers in Sweden without a prescription?
Yes. Travelers can purchase standard OTC medications like Alvedon (paracetamol) or Ipren (ibuprofen) straight from any drug store without a prescription. No regional individuality number (personnummer) is required for over-the-counter deals.
3. What is the Swedish equivalent of Tylenol or Paracetamol?
The most common brand names for paracetamol in Sweden are Alvedon and Panodil. Pharmacists will quickly understand if you request "paracetamol."
4. Why are package sizes for pain relievers so small in Sweden?
Sweden implements strict public health policies designed to minimize the threat of deliberate or accidental overdoses, particularly with paracetamol. Consequently, retail pack sizes are kept fairly little, and purchasing numerous boxes simultaneously may activate restrictions.
